    Riverdale (CW) - Season 4 October 9, 2019

    A Darker side of Archie & Friends
    Executive producer Greg Berlanti already has a copy of Roberto Aguirre-Sacasa's pilot script for the Archie Comics-driven TV series Riverdale, CW chief Mark Pedowitz revealed today at the Television Critics Association.

    The series, which was born at FOX and came to The CW when that network passed on it, has been described as "Archie meets Twin Peaks" and will be darker than previous multimedia takes on Riverdale.

    That approach will lend itself to The Simpsons Treehouse of Horror-style Afterlife With Archie episodes, according to previous reports. Aguirre-Sacasa, the chief creative officer at Archie, established himself as one of their best-selling and most critically acclaimed writers in no small part with the Afterlife comics.

    The live-action series offers a bold, subversive take on Archie, Betty, Veronica, and their friends, exploring small-town life and the darkness and weirdness bubbling beneath Riverdale’s wholesome facade. The show will focus on the eternal love triangle of Archie Andrews, girl-next-door Betty Cooper, and rich socialite Veronica Lodge, and will include the entire cast of characters from the comic books—including Archie’s rival, Reggie Mantle, and his slacker best friend, Jughead Jones.

    Popular gay character Kevin Keller will also play a pivotal role. In addition to the core cast, “Riverdale” will introduce other characters from Archie Comics’ expansive library, including Josie and the Pussycats.
